Ingredients Commonly Found in Food Coloring
Food coloring, in essence, is a carefully crafted blend. Here’s a breakdown of the usual suspects:
- Dyes: These are the stars of the show, the molecules responsible for the color. They’re either synthetic (man-made) or natural. Synthetic dyes are typically derived from petroleum and are highly concentrated, providing intense and consistent color. Natural dyes come from sources like plants and insects, offering a more subtle color range.
- Water or Solvent: This acts as the carrier, dissolving and suspending the dyes, making it easy to mix them into food. Liquid food coloring commonly uses water, while gels might use a combination of water and glycerin.
- Additives: These are the supporting cast. They can include preservatives (to extend shelf life), humectants (to prevent drying), and stabilizers (to maintain color consistency). Some common additives are sodium benzoate (a preservative), glycerin (a humectant), and citric acid (a stabilizer).
- Salt (in some cases): Sometimes, a small amount of salt is added to help with the dye’s solubility or to act as a preservative.
Chemical Properties Contributing to Staining Potential
The staining power of food coloring comes down to its chemical properties. Let’s uncover the secrets:
- Chromophores: These are the color-bearing components of the dye molecules. They contain conjugated systems (alternating single and double bonds), which absorb certain wavelengths of light and reflect others, creating the color we see. The stronger the chromophore, the more intense the color and the higher the staining potential.
- Molecular Size: Smaller dye molecules can penetrate fabrics more easily than larger ones, leading to deeper staining.
- Charge: Dye molecules can be charged (ionic) or neutral. Charged dyes can interact with charged sites on fabric fibers, increasing the likelihood of binding and staining.
- Solubility: The dye’s ability to dissolve in water or other solvents impacts its spreading and penetration. Higher solubility generally means easier staining.
- Affinity for Fabric: Dyes have varying affinities for different materials. Some dyes are more attracted to cotton, while others prefer silk or wool. This attraction determines how strongly the dye bonds to the fabric fibers.
Differences Between Liquid, Gel, and Powder Food Coloring in Terms of Staining Ability
The form of food coloring affects its staining potential. Let’s compare:
- Liquid Food Coloring: This is the most common type. It typically contains a relatively low concentration of dye in a water-based solution. It tends to spread easily, making it prone to staining if spilled.
- Gel Food Coloring: Gels are more concentrated than liquids, containing a higher proportion of dye. They also usually have a thicker consistency due to the addition of glycerin or other thickening agents. Because of the higher dye concentration, gel food coloring generally has a higher staining potential than liquids. However, the thicker consistency can sometimes limit its spread.
- Powder Food Coloring: Powdered food coloring is the most concentrated form. It contains pure dye pigments. Because it is a dry powder, it may not stain as readily until it’s dissolved in water. However, once dissolved, the concentrated dye can stain very effectively. It requires careful handling.
Types of Dyes Used in Food Coloring and Their Properties
Dyes are the heart of food coloring. Here’s a look at the common types:
- Synthetic Dyes (Artificial Colors): These are man-made and are often preferred for their vibrant and consistent colors. They’re highly concentrated and provide a wide range of hues.
- Examples:
- FD&C Red No. 40 (Allura Red): Produces a bright red color and is widely used in candies, beverages, and baked goods.
- FD&C Yellow No. 5 (Tartrazine): Gives a yellow hue and is often found in soft drinks, snacks, and desserts.
- FD&C Blue No. 1 (Brilliant Blue): Provides a vibrant blue color and is used in ice cream, candies, and other products.
- FD&C Yellow No. 6 (Sunset Yellow): Creates an orange-yellow color and is used in various food items.
- Properties: Synthetic dyes are generally very stable, providing consistent color over time and under different conditions (like heat or light). They are typically water-soluble.
- Natural Dyes: Derived from natural sources like plants, insects, and minerals. They offer a more “natural” option, but their colors may be less intense and less stable than synthetic dyes.
- Examples:
- Carmine: A red dye derived from cochineal insects.
- Turmeric: Provides a yellow color.
- Beet juice: Used for a red or pink color.
- Spirulina: A blue-green algae used to produce blue and green colors.
- Properties: Natural dyes are often less stable and may fade more easily when exposed to light or heat. Their color intensity can vary depending on the source and processing method. Solubility depends on the specific dye.

Washing Clothes with Food Coloring Stains: A Step-by-Step Guide
This guide will help you wash your clothes and get rid of those stubborn food coloring stains. Remember to act quickly, as the longer the stain sits, the harder it is to remove. Here’s the step-by-step:
- Pre-Treat the Stain: First, rinse the stained area with cold water. Then, apply a stain remover specifically designed for colored stains or a mixture of liquid dish soap and water. Gently rub the stain with your fingers or a soft brush.
- Soak (Optional): For tougher stains, soak the garment in cold water with a stain remover or enzyme detergent for at least 30 minutes, or even overnight. This helps to loosen the stain before washing.
- Choose the Right Water Temperature: Always use cold water, especially for the first wash. Hot water can set the stain and make it even harder to remove.
- Select the Correct Detergent: Use a high-quality detergent that is formulated for removing stains. Enzyme detergents are particularly effective at breaking down food coloring. Avoid using bleach at this stage, as it can sometimes set the stain.
- Wash the Garment: Wash the stained garment separately, if possible, to prevent the stain from spreading to other clothes. If you have to wash it with other clothes, choose similar colors to minimize the risk of color transfer.
- Inspect Before Drying: After washing, check if the stain is gone before putting the garment in the dryer. If the stain is still visible, repeat the washing process.
- Air Dry: Air-dry the garment. Heat from the dryer can set any remaining stain. If the stain is gone after air drying, you can then machine dry the clothes.
Selecting the Correct Water Temperature and Detergent Type
Choosing the right water temperature and detergent is key to successful stain removal. Here’s what you need to know:
- Water Temperature: Cold water is the best choice for food coloring stains. Hot water can cause the stain to set and become permanent. Cold water also helps to preserve the color and integrity of your clothes.
- Detergent Type: Enzyme detergents are the best option for removing food coloring stains. Enzymes break down the proteins and pigments in the stain, making it easier to wash away. Other options include detergents formulated for stain removal and liquid dish soap, especially for spot treatment.
- Bleach: Avoid using bleach directly on food coloring stains, as it can sometimes make the stain worse or change the color of the fabric. Only use bleach if the fabric is white and the stain has not responded to other treatments. Always test bleach in an inconspicuous area first.
The Potential Impact of Using a Washing Machine with Other Stained Clothes
Washing stained clothes with other items can have consequences, so be careful, yo!
- Color Transfer: Food coloring can bleed from the stained garment and transfer to other clothes in the wash, especially if the water temperature is too high. This can ruin other garments and spread the stain.
- Stain Spread: The food coloring can spread throughout the washing machine, contaminating other items and potentially staining them as well.
- Recommendation: It’s best to wash heavily stained clothes separately. If you must wash them with other items, choose similar colors and wash on a cold water setting. Always inspect the clothes after washing to ensure no color transfer has occurred.
The Importance of Air-Drying Versus Machine-Drying Clothes with Stains
Drying your clothes properly after washing is critical to removing the food coloring stain completely.
- Air-Drying: Air-drying is the safest option. Heat from the dryer can set any remaining stain, making it impossible to remove. Air-drying allows you to assess whether the stain is completely gone.
- Machine-Drying: Only machine-dry the garment after you are sure the stain is completely gone. If the stain is still visible, the heat from the dryer can set the stain permanently.
- Inspection is Key: Always check the garment for stains after washing and before drying. If the stain is still there, repeat the washing process.

Common Myths About Food Coloring Stains
There’s a lot of salah kaprah (misunderstanding) about food coloring stains. Let’s clear up some of the most popular ones:
- Myth: All food coloring stains are impossible to remove.
Fact: Not true! While some stains are trickier than others, especially those from gel food coloring, most can be removed with the right techniques and a little sabar (patience).
- Myth: Hot water always works best for stain removal.
Fact: This can be a big no-no, especially for protein-based stains. Hot water can actually set some food coloring stains, making them permanent. Cold water is often the best starting point.
- Myth: Bleach is always the answer.
Fact: Bleach can damage some fabrics and may not even work on all food coloring stains. It’s important to test it on a hidden area first and to choose the right type of bleach for your fabric.
- Myth: Old stains are impossible to remove.
Fact: While older stains are more challenging, they can still be removed, especially if you try different stain removal methods. The key is to be persistent and try different approaches.

Using Lemon Juice for Stain Removal
Lemon juice, si asam segar, is a natural bleaching agent and can be surprisingly effective against food coloring stains. The citric acid helps to break down the dye molecules. However, remember to test it on an inconspicuous area of the fabric first to make sure it doesn’t discolor your clothes.
- Application: Squeeze fresh lemon juice directly onto the stain. Make sure the stain is fully saturated with the juice.
- Sunlight Boost: Place the stained garment in direct sunlight. The sun’s rays will further enhance the bleaching action of the lemon juice. Be careful with colored fabrics, as prolonged exposure to sunlight can cause fading.
- Rinse and Wash: After about 30 minutes to an hour, rinse the garment thoroughly with cold water. Then, wash it as usual with your regular detergent.
- Effectiveness: Lemon juice is most effective on fresh stains and lighter-colored fabrics. It might not be as effective on darker stains or heavily dyed materials.
Using Vinegar for Stain Removal
Cuka, a household staple, is another powerful natural stain remover. Its acidity can help to dissolve and lift the food coloring. White vinegar is preferred to avoid staining.
- Application: Mix equal parts white vinegar and water. Soak the stained area in this solution for about 30 minutes.
- Gentle Scrubbing: Gently scrub the stain with a soft-bristled brush or a clean cloth. This helps to loosen the dye particles.
- Rinse and Wash: Rinse the garment thoroughly with cold water and then wash it as usual.
- Odor Consideration: Vinegar has a strong smell. The smell usually disappears after washing and drying. You can add a little baking soda to the wash cycle to help neutralize the odor.
Using Baking Soda for Stain Removal
Baking soda, or soda kue, is a gentle abrasive and a natural deodorizer. It can absorb the food coloring and help lift it from the fabric.
- Application: Make a paste by mixing baking soda with a small amount of water. The paste should be thick enough to stay on the stain.
- Application: Apply the paste directly onto the stain, covering it completely.
- Gentle Rubbing: Gently rub the paste into the stain with your fingers or a soft cloth.
- Drying and Washing: Let the paste dry completely. Once dry, brush off the baking soda and wash the garment as usual.
- Enhanced Effectiveness: For tougher stains, you can add a little vinegar to the baking soda paste. The fizzing action can help to break down the stain.
